The Aleutian Tern (Onychoprion aleuticus) is a bird species in the family Laridae (gulls & terns), within the order Charadriiformes (shorebirds & gulls). Recorded measurements include a wingspan of 52.4 cm and a weight of 104.9 g. The IUCN Red List classifies it as Vulnerable.

حول

Aleutian Tern, 32–34 cm, breeds colonially in Alaska and Russian Far East, wintering in Southeast Asian waters — one of the most poorly tracked migrations among seabirds. Dark grey above, white below, black cap with white forehead. Piscivore; dives for small fish. Near Threatened.
